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: 1. Parous pregnant women having fear after childbirth are eligible to take part 2. Those who belong to the lower middle, upper lower, and lower class in the modified kuppuswamy scale i.e. score between 5 and 1 3. A willingness to take part in the research 4. Those who had a traumatic birth experience 5. Parous pregnant women who are in their second or third trimester
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1. Women not willing to participate in the study 2. Those who have previously taken a childbirth education class during this pregnancy will be excluded 3. Expectant mothers with moderate and high-risk pregnancies, such as those with diabetes, hypertension, or pre-eclampsia 4. Women who use medications for a diagnosed mental disorder (e.g., antidepressants, anti-anxiety, or anti-psychotic drugs) 5. Women experiencing a perinatal death (e.g., congenital abnormalities incompatible with life) stillbirth, or postpartum complications (bleeding, puerperal infection, mastitis, thrombolytic disease, or postpartum psychiatric disorder) 6. Those who have had previous C-section or any other perineum surgeries 7. Women who have a recurrent history of miscarriages 8. Women who are presented with breech presentation in the third trimester
